From the outset, Severn made flexibility a key driving force in the design of the Oblique Cone Technology (OCT) Triple Offset (TOV) Butterfly Valve. Due to Severns extensive diverse engineering heritage and excellence, our expert team of engineers understand that processes and application product demands change over time, whether it is the process conditions or the overall requirements of the valve for the end user. Due to this understanding, the Oblique Cone Technology Triple Offset Butterfly Valve has been designed to incorporate multiple seal options, all fully interchangeable with each other, providing maximum application diversity and usability to ensure safe operations and minimum downtime making it ideal for oil & gas isolation, refinery valve applications, petrochemical process valves, and critical shutdown and control operations.
The Laminate seal is the “traditional” Triple Offset Valve seal and consists of multiple metal and graphite layers providing isolation sealing for high‑temperature, high‑pressure, and severe‑service applications.
The OCT HS seal is a hybrid polymer metallic seal, this seal benefits from a primary metal seal and secondary polymer seal, this provides a reliable and repeatable bubble tight seal time after time. This can also be paired with PTFE packings when graphite being in contact with the line media is a concern. The polymer seal is fully compliant with EN ISO 80079-36 (ATEX) making it an excellent choice for ATEX‑rated butterfly valves, hydrocarbon service valves, and zero‑leakage industrial valves.

The OCT SW Valve takes the hybrid sealing to the next level with its versatile high performance. Severn utilises the OCT-HS seal and has designed a valve that ensure there is no graphite in contact with the line media to remove the risk of costly galvanic effects such as internal corrosion leading to valve failure. Whilst doing so the OCT-SW also maintains firesafe certification making it suitable for Firesafe Triple Offset Valves, API 607 certified valves, and critical isolation applications in hazardous environments.

Should the sealing requirement not become as critical, and process conditions become more arduous, the Laminate and Hybrid seals can be changed for the OCT-SS solid seal. As the name suggests it is a solid metallic seal, that can be made from hard-wearing alloys to add longevity to the sealing life of the valve in arduous conditions and can offer a control valve seat leakage ideal for erosion‑resistant valve applications, abrasive service, and high‑cycle industrial operations.

Based on Severns comprehensive history of severe service control, our team of engineering experts work closely with operators and end uses to identify the correct seal and material selection to provide the maximum reliability and productivity further ensuring minimum downtime supporting industries such as LNG, chemical processing, power generation, and midstream pipeline operations.
All the OCT seals are interchangeable and can be upgraded without the need for main valve components being replaced, further emphasising the OCT TOV Butterfly Valves versatility. The fully in field serviceable valve can be upgraded on-site without the need for specialist tools or knowledge, this further ensures that costly unplanned downtime and site waste is kept to a minimum, along with potential loss in production for the end user. All the seal options can be changed on site within a small space of time to ensure site maintenance costs are reduced by upgrading the existing valve rather than discarding and replacing with a commodity product each time making it a cost-efficient solution for industrial valve maintenance, asset lifecycle extension, and retrofit valve upgrades.

Severn’s engineering heritage and excellence in valve manufacturing has led to the innovative design of a product that can master both Control & Isolation applications within critical flow control systems.
Utilising Severn’s long history with Control Valve design, our team of valve engineering experts have been able to manufacture a Triple Offset Butterfly Valve that can be used to provide superior flow control performance in both throttling and modulating service, whilst additionally providing a repeatable, bubble‑tight seal for isolation valve duties.
By designing a Control Valve that can isolate, rather than an isolation valve that attempts to control (which may initially sound similar but is fundamentally different in performance outcome), Severn has developed a high‑performance butterfly valve that maximises Cv through streamlined internal geometry. This delivers optimal flow characteristics, improved process controllability, and stable valve performance under variable operating conditions.
This distinction is critical for industries requiring precise process control, reliable shut‑off, and long‑term operational safety, particularly within oil & gas, energy, offshore, chemical processing, and industrial fluid handling systems.
Designing for Reliability, Safety, and Performance
Severn has eliminated the need for disc fasteners or bolted‑on seals, allowing further optimisation of the disc profile. By removing fasteners from the disc:
- Flow efficiency is improved
- Pressure drop is reduced
Risk of loose components entering the pipeline due to vibration is eliminated
This approach significantly enhances operational reliability, particularly in high‑vibration and severe service environments.





By adopting a body‑mounted sealing arrangement, Severn has increased both the longevity and reliability of the valve. Removing the seal from the direct flow path of the process media reduces wear, enabling Severn to:
- Increase effective bore size
- Maximise Cv
- Extend service life in demanding applications
Patented Oblique Cone Technology (OCT)
Using Severn’s Patented Oblique Cone Technology (OCT), the valve utilises circular sealing geometry that ensures an even seal load distribution around the circumference of the disc.
This technology provides:
- Repeatable bubble‑tight shut‑off
- Improved operational safety
- Enhanced process reliability
- Reduced downtime and maintenance intervention
Ensuring customers consistently meet their core remit of safe operations and minimum downtime.
Advanced Trims for Severe Service Conditions
The OCT geometry enables Severn to offer an extensive range of control valve trims not traditionally associated with Triple Offset Butterfly Valves.
- By utilising a one‑piece disc design, Severn can incorporate:
- Anti‑cavitation trims
- Noise‑reduction solutions
- Flow conditioning elements
- Baffle plates for severe service control
This allows the valve to operate effectively in high‑pressure drop, high‑velocity, and erosive flow conditions, where a conventional butterfly valve would typically suffer reduced service life or performance limitations.
